I found this dish to be a little bland, so you might need to add some salt.
- 1 box of spaghetti (I just used the left over pasta from the packet I hadn't cooked from the previous dishes)
- 500g beef strips
- 2 cloves garlic
- 2 tablespoons oil
- 3 cups of broccoli florettes
- 1 medium capsicum, sliced
- 1 medium onion, cut in wedges
- 2-3 teaspoons ginger
- 1 can coconut milk
- 2 tablespoons red curry paste
- roasted nuts
1. Cook the pasta according to the packet directions.
2. In a large frypan, cook the beef strips and garlic in the oil.
3. Add the broccoli, capsicum and onion and cook for 1 minute.
4. Add 1-2 tablespoons water and ginger, combined with the coconut milk and the curry paste.
5. Bring to the boil, reduce heat and simmer for 3-5 minutes.
6. Toss with the pasta and garnish with nuts.
